What it is

Qwen3.8-27B-Cold-Fusion-GAIN-V1.1 is a third-party fine-tune of Qwen3.8-27B released as GGUF quantizations for local inference.

  • Text: generates text locally.
  • Images: processes images when mmproj is present.
  • Reasoning: provides three reasoning levels.
  • Quantization: ships standard and MTP quants.

MTP requires checking token acceptance on your specific hardware. Test it locally against official Qwen3.8-27B on your own tasks instead of relying on author benchmarks.

What changed

2026-08-20 — DavidAU/Qwen3.8-27B-Cold-Fusion-GAIN-V1.1-NM-DAU-NEO-MAX-MTP-GGUF released: Apache-2.0 GGUF release with standard and MTP quants, including Q4_K_M.

The model card adds the full name, three reasoning modes (xhigh, medium, low), 256k context, and a separate mmproj requirement for images. The accessible card shows no publication date, so we do not claim a more precise source date.

We found no new dated steps tied to the development of this specific model.

How to use this

As of 2026-08-20, evaluate the linked GGUF artifact as a distinct Qwen derivative, checking its provenance, configuration, and capabilities before use.

  1. Install llama.cpp and run the selected Q4_K_M build with llama serve -hf …:Q4_K_M, then check outputs on your task. — https://huggingface.co/DavidAU/Qwen3.8-27B-Cold-Fusion-GAIN-V1.1-NM-DAU-NEO-MAX-MTP-GGUF
  2. For quick local execution, run ollama run hf.co/…:Q4_K_M. — https://huggingface.co/DavidAU/Qwen3.8-27B-Cold-Fusion-GAIN-V1.1-NM-DAU-NEO-MAX-MTP-GGUF
  3. To process images, download one compatible mmproj file and place it next to the GGUF. — https://huggingface.co/DavidAU/Qwen3.8-27B-Cold-Fusion-GAIN-V1.1-NM-DAU-NEO-MAX-MTP-GGUF

Still unknown

  • The model card provides no creation date or commit history, so we cannot date the release more precisely than 2026-08-20.
  • Author claims of preserved performance, fewer thinking tokens, and benchmark wins lack independent reproducible verification.
  • No specific revision or commit links the Cold-Fusion weights to official Qwen/Qwen3.8-27B.
